From 28b396895abdd2403de13af52c67280b302b808c Mon Sep 17 00:00:00 2001 From: Damien Elmes Date: Mon, 19 Mar 2012 20:35:25 +0900 Subject: [PATCH] must make sure to save odid on sched flush --- anki/cards.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/anki/cards.py b/anki/cards.py index c896a2915..1f5073989 100644 --- a/anki/cards.py +++ b/anki/cards.py @@ -98,10 +98,10 @@ insert or replace into cards values self.col.db.execute( """update cards set mod=?, usn=?, type=?, queue=?, due=?, ivl=?, factor=?, reps=?, -lapses=?, left=?, odue=?, did=? where id = ?""", +lapses=?, left=?, odue=?, odid=?, did=? where id = ?""", self.mod, self.usn, self.type, self.queue, self.due, self.ivl, self.factor, self.reps, self.lapses, - self.left, self.odue, self.did, self.id) + self.left, self.odue, self.odid, self.did, self.id) def q(self, reload=False): return self.css() + self._getQA(reload)['q']